The Upcoming Celebrating America's 250th Anniversary: A Tribute to 250 Years of Freedom and Commitment will take place on Saturday, June 27, 2026, from 9:00 AM to 12:00 PM at the Columbia VA Regional Office, 6437 Garners Ferry Road, Columbia, SC 29209

This event is designed for veterans, caregivers, and family members to connect with representatives from various service lines, including the Columbia Vet Center, the Veterans Benefits Administration (VBA), and the National Cemetery Administration (NCA). VA staff will be available to answer questions regarding benefits, health care, and support services. Additionally, veterans can learn more about the PACT Act and its related benefits, enroll in VA health care, process or renew a VA health care ID card, file a disability claim and discover resources tailored to support veterans and their families. Enjoy complimentary food and refreshments provided by the South Carolina American Legion.
